(1) The regulator must
give the licence holder written notice of a decision under regulation 520
to suspend or cancel an asbestos removal licence or asbestos assessor licence
within 14 days after making the decision.
(2) The notice
must—
(a)
state that the licence is to be suspended or cancelled; and
(b) if
the licence is to be suspended, state—
(i)
when the suspension begins and ends; and
(ii)
the reasons for the suspension; and
(iii)
whether the licence holder is required to undergo
retraining or reassessment or take any other action before the suspension
ends; and
(iv)
whether or not the licence holder is disqualified from
applying for a further licence during the suspension; and
(c) if
the licence is to be cancelled, state—
(i)
when the cancellation takes effect; and
(ii)
the reasons for the cancellation; and
(iii)
whether or not the licence holder is disqualified from
applying for a further licence; and
(d) if
the licence holder is disqualified from applying for a further licence,
state—
(i)
when the disqualification begins and ends; and
(ii)
the reasons for the disqualification; and
(iii)
whether or not the licence holder is required to undergo
retraining or reassessment or take any other action before the
disqualification ends; and
(iv)
any other class of licence under these regulations that
the licence holder is disqualified from applying for; and
(e)
state when the licence document must be returned to the regulator.
